如何对Twitter Bootstrap项目进行代码审查?

时间:2017-02-22 06:12:58

标签: css twitter-bootstrap

我正在制定一个计划,在为引导项目设计团队时进行代码审查,以减少缺陷并提高质量。
 我已经为代码审查清单起草了一些问题,我将在下面粘贴 此清单中还包含哪些问题或指向检查开发人员代码以确保代码质量?

  1. bootstrap.css未修改?
  2. 选择有意义且必需的插件
  3. 避免显示多个模态提示
  4. 之前或之后放置模态的HTML
  5. 遵循bootstrap的命名约定?
  6. 最新版本的bootstrap被使用了吗?
  7. 将容器 - 流体类用于全宽行而不是全宽行吗?
  8. 您是否根据bootstrap css使用了正确的媒体查询中断点?
  9. 用于使设计响应的Bootstrap网格?
  10. 这些清单问题尚未完成,需要您的指导和帮助才能进行完整的代码审核。

1 个答案:

答案 0 :(得分:1)

  1. Bootstrap设计为移动优先方法,因此您应始终检查是否已遵循移动优先方法。
  2. Bootstrap是一个庞大的库,因此您应该检查是否所有组件都已正确使用。例如。有许多组件,如accordion, panels, carousel,可以使您的设计紧凑,看起来很好。
  3. 检查所有列是否都包含在<div class="row"></div>内,因为这是使用bootstrap的正确方法。
  4. 检查引导程序cdns是否在页面中被使用了两次。原因,如果在一个pge中使用包括bootstrap cdns两次会干扰某些元素的正常运行。
  5. 以下应该是bootstrap cdns -

    的顺序
    <link rel="stylesheet" href="http://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/css/bootstrap.min.css">
          <script src="https://ajax.googleapis.com/ajax/libs/jquery/1.12.4/jquery.min.js"></script>
          <script src="http://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/js/bootstrap.min.js"></script>
    

    这些是您在审核时应该检查的一些基本内容。

    修改

    表现

    查看此回答https://webmasters.stackexchange.com/questions/52502/how-can-i-speed-up-the-download-time-of-a-bootstrap-themed-website

    <强>文档

    The Official website

    许多其他文档可在线获取。check out this

    编码标准

    现在对我而言,这是一个相对的术语,并根据需要而变化。

    注意

    只是我个人观点的一个建议,在审查时不要过于拘泥于规则。如果一段代码显然是错误的,但优雅地解决问题,我会接受。

    希望这有帮助!